Powerbuilder con MySql
Estoy desarrollando en PowerBuilder 5.02 y quiero usar una BD en mysql (a través de ODBC) para estudiar su rendimiento. Mi sorpresa ha sido que al usar sentencias embebidas en PB no se obtienen los resultados deseados. He aquí el problema:
long ll_pk // variable a grabar por SQL directo
ll_pk = 56 //cargo la variable
INSERT INTO <TABLA> (campo) values (:ll_pk); //lanzo la sentencia
esta sentencia me graba CAMPO = 5 ?????? Se ha comido el 6
Bien, pues esto pasa con todos los valores INT que use, en los que siempre solo me graba la primera cifra y se come el resto
he descubierto que si convierto a cadena ll_pk funciona correctamente, pero eso es inadmisible, porque el programa ha de ser transportable a SQL-ANYWHERE y a INFORMIX. Por cierto que con estas BD'S todo va correctamente.
long ll_pk // variable a grabar por SQL directo
ll_pk = 56 //cargo la variable
INSERT INTO <TABLA> (campo) values (:ll_pk); //lanzo la sentencia
esta sentencia me graba CAMPO = 5 ?????? Se ha comido el 6
Bien, pues esto pasa con todos los valores INT que use, en los que siempre solo me graba la primera cifra y se come el resto
he descubierto que si convierto a cadena ll_pk funciona correctamente, pero eso es inadmisible, porque el programa ha de ser transportable a SQL-ANYWHERE y a INFORMIX. Por cierto que con estas BD'S todo va correctamente.
2 Respuestas
Respuesta de bankhacker
1
Respuesta
1